岄. 2023-11-10 10:39 采纳率: 91.7%
浏览 20
已结题

我使用海康威视3.2无插件开发包,但部署到服务器上就登录失败报错404,如何解决?

我使用海康威视3.2无插件开发包,本地测试可以,但部署到服务器上就登录失败报错404

img

这是我的nginx.conf文件

img

  • 写回答

1条回答 默认 最新

  • CSDN-Ada助手 CSDN-AI 官方账号 2023-11-10 12:02
    关注

    【以下回答由 GPT 生成】

    对于这个问题,首先需要查看nginx.conf文件,确保配置正确。

    # 示例配置
    server {
        listen 80;
        server_name your_domain.com;
    
        location / {
            root /path/to/your/app;
            index index.html;
            try_files $uri $uri/ /index.html;
        }
    }
    

    对于海康威视3.2无插件开发包,一般会包含一些特殊的URL路径。如果部署时出现404错误,可能是由于nginx没有正确处理这些URL路径。

    要解决这个问题,可以尝试以下几个步骤:

    1. 在nginx.conf文件中添加一个location块,用于处理特殊的URL路径。将下面的代码添加到server块中。

    nginx location /特殊的URL路径/ { proxy_pass http://应用程序的IP和端口; }

    其中,将"特殊的URL路径"替换为海康威视开发包中特殊的URL路径;将"应用程序的IP和端口"替换为实际部署的应用程序的IP和端口。

    1. 重新加载nginx配置,启动或重启nginx服务。

    bash sudo nginx -s reload

    运行以上命令可以重新加载nginx配置。

    1. 测试登录功能。在浏览器中输入服务器的IP和端口,并尝试使用海康威视开发包的登录功能。如果登录成功,并且没有出现404错误,那么问题已经解决了。

    如果上述步骤没有解决问题,有可能是其他原因引起的。此时建议参考海康威视开发包的官方文档或寻求专业的技术支持。

    希望以上信息对您有所帮助!如果还有其他问题,请随时提问。



    【相关推荐】



    如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已结题 (查看结题原因) 11月17日
  • 已采纳回答 11月17日
  • 创建了问题 11月10日

悬赏问题

  • ¥15 spaceclaim模型变灰色
  • ¥15 求一份华为esight平台V300R009C00SPC200这个型号的api接口文档
  • ¥15 就很莫名其妙,本来正常的Excel,突然变成了这种一格一页
  • ¥15 字符串比较代码的漏洞
  • ¥15 欧拉系统opt目录空间使用100%
  • ¥15 ul做导航栏格式不对怎么改?
  • ¥20 用户端如何上传图片到服务器和数据库里
  • ¥15 现在研究生在烦开题,看了一些文献,但不知道自己要做什么,求指导。
  • ¥30 vivado封装时总是显示缺少一个dcp文件
  • ¥100 pxe uefi启动 tinycore